vlookup跨表两个表格匹配[vlookup跨表提取数据]

下面的Excel工资表表格,记录了人员的工资和社保个税情况。

vlookup跨表两个表格匹配[vlookup跨表提取数据]

根据上面的工资表数据,在下面的“查询表”输入一个公式,快速填写所有的数据。

vlookup跨表两个表格匹配[vlookup跨表提取数据]

函数公式分享:

B2单元格输入公式:

=IFERROR(VLOOKUP($A2,工资表!$A:$H,COLUMN(B1),0),0)

vlookup跨表两个表格匹配[vlookup跨表提取数据]

公式解释:

查找“陈泽俊”的工资,可以使用VLOOKUP函数的基本用法完成。

=VLOOKUP(A2,工资表!A:H,2,0)

为了公式做到右拉下拉都一次性得到所有结果,就需要将上面的公式进行优化。

优化1:单元格引用方式改变:=VLOOKUP($A2,工资表!$A:$H,2,0)

优化2:VLOOKUP函数第3参数2,使用COLUMN函数代替手动数查找的列。

=VLOOKUP($A2,工资表!$A:$H,COLUMN(B1),0)

优化3:有一些姓名,在工资表里面没有,所以查找不到,会返回NA错误。为了屏蔽NA错误,所以外面嵌套IFERROR函数。

因此最终公式为:

=IFERROR(VLOOKUP($A2,工资表!$A:$H,COLUMN(B1),0),0)

小伙伴们在看公式有不理解的地方,请在微信群交流。如果没有加入,请添加微信邀请入群。

(59)
打赏 微信扫一扫 微信扫一扫
上一篇 2022年12月10日
下一篇 2022年12月10日

相关推荐

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请联系我们,一经查实,本站将立刻删除。